  • Title

    A neuro-fuzzy approach to the capacitated vehicle routing problem

  • Abstract
    Presents an approach to the vehicle routing problem. The method is based on self-organizing maps with one-dimensional neighborhood, adjustable number of neurons and network training guided by fuzzy rules. The distinctive aspect is the successful application of the algorithm to several instances while keeping parameters unchanged
